    HG> What are those test pits for?   
      
   we have to see what the soil is like for construction projects... in this   
   case, they're going to be stripping off a lot of the woods/forest and turning   
   it into an apartment complex... they have to know what the soil material is   
   like and how much weight it can hold as well as the moisture content... all   
   this for the foundations and concrete pads the structures will be built on...   
      
    ml>> the pits dug, we ran some penetration tests to see how firm the soil   
    ml>> material is at that point... one of our holes was 25 feet (7.62 meters)   
    ml>> deep... some grueling work at times climbing up and working on the   
    ml>> slopes in those conditions...
